I am hoping some-one can help me with a duo battery problem I am having with my 2-PB2300c's (1 has os 9.1 and the other has 8.1) and my 1-PB280c (has 8.1). The batteries are 1-Nicad, 1-TypeII, and 2-TypeIII. All these batteries show up when placed into the different duo's as fully charged ! None of the Duo's will boot from any of the batteries. All these Batteries were good execpt the 1-nicad. Apple's Recondioner will never stop trying to recondion the typeII and III batteries. The 1-Nicad makes the Recondioner app crash.
